Overview

We are looking for a strategic and driven Talent Acquisition Partner - Drivers to lead recruitment efforts for our driver workforce across the United States. This role is critical in ensuring we attract, engage, and hire top-tier commercial and non-commercial drivers to support our growing logistics and transportation operations.

As a key member of the Talent Acquisition team, you'll serve as a trusted advisor to operational leadership and hiring managers-developing innovative sourcing strategies, managing full-cycle recruitment, and delivering a best-in-class candidate experience.



Responsibilities

    Recruitment Strategy & Execution
    Own the full-cycle recruitment process for driver positions (CDL and non-CDL),. Develop and execute strategic plans to meet aggressive hiring targets and support business growth.
  • Sourcing & Talent Pipelining
    Identify, attract, and engage passive and active candidates using a mix of sourcing channels, including job boards, social media, community partnerships, CDL schools, and referral programs.
  • Partnership & Advisory
    Act as a consultative partner to hiring managers and regional operations leaders, offering data-informed insights on labor market trends, hiring challenges, and talent availability.
  • Candidate Experience
    Champion an exceptional candidate experience, ensuring every applicant feels informed, respected, and aligned with our core values throughout the hiring process.
  • Compliance & Documentation
    Ensure all hiring activities adhere to DOT regulations, EEO guidelines, and internal compliance standards. Maintain accurate records in our Applicant Tracking System (iCIMS and Tenstreet).
  • Metrics & Continuous Improvement
    Track recruiting metrics (time-to-fill, pipeline conversion rates, source performance) to continuously improve processes and outcomes. Recommend process enhancements based on data insights.
  • Performs other duties as assigned
  • Complies with all policies and standards
  • The wage range for this position is $65,000.00-$100,000.00 and may vary based on geography as well as relative knowledge, skills, abilities, and experience

About AIT Worldwide

AIT Worldwide Logistics is a global freight forwarder that helps companies grow by expanding access to markets all over the world where they can sell and/or procure their raw materials, components and finished goods. For more than 40 years, the Chicago-based supply chain solutions leader has relied on a consultative approach to build a global network and trusted partnerships in nearly every industry, including aerospace, automotive, consumer retail, energy, food, government, high-tech, industrial, life sciences and marine. Backed by scalable, user-friendly technology, AIT's flexible business model customizes door-to-door deliveries via sea, air, ground and rail-on time and on budget. With expert teammates staffing more than 150 worldwide locations in Asia, Europe and North America, AIT's full-service options also include customs clearance, warehouse management and white glove services.
